Herat, the ancient jewel of Central Asia, has always been renowned as a center of science, culture, and art in the Islamic world. The city was not only home to great scholars, mystics, and jurists, but also a place where religious sciences, philosophy, literature, and fine arts flourished.

Throughout different historical periods, especially during the Timurid era, Herat became known as the “City of Culture and Art,” with numerous universities, religious schools, and libraries. Great scholars and poets such as Mawlana Abdul Rahman Jami and Sayyid Ismail Jalali lived in Herat and produced their works there.

Handicrafts, magnificent architecture, Quranic calligraphy, and miniature painting also flourished in the city. For this reason, Herat is not only recognized as a center of knowledge, but also as a symbol of cultural and civilizational splendor in Central Asia, and it has the potential to become a hub of science and culture once again.

After approximately three years of research and consultation, and a ten-month testing period, the family of the Solidarity Committee Afghanistan Netherlands (SCAN) is proud to launch the major project “Education – The Golden Key to a Better Future” in Herat.

The project provides transparent, sustainable, and effective access to education for all, a unique educational initiative in Afghanistan, supported by a committed family from Hamburg. Around 30 family members have not only invested financially but are actively participating in the project.

Project Objective:
To create real opportunities for children from low-income families, going beyond just attending school. Daily supplementary classes include:

  • English language
  • IT skills such as programming and web design
  • Creative skills such as video editing and animation
  • Working with software such as Photoshop
  • Accounting and digital skills

Classes are held daily after school (1–2 hours), and safe transport for children is provided.
